Output 6e01ce23a41d2607e751d2f3f6b9539961ba18414609aa82e1da92f47857934a:166

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 267bcb91f9289020b9d02a1635f83b0060e43225e123db92cbf4cf920758d6c4
address
bc1pyeauhy0e9zgzpwws9gtrt7pmqpswgv39uy3ahykt7n8eyp6c6mzqn34dd9
transaction
6e01ce23a41d2607e751d2f3f6b9539961ba18414609aa82e1da92f47857934a
spent
true